In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ding BD18 3TH,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.2%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Bradford Road was 24.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 78.3% lower than the Heaton average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Bradford Road has the 4th lowest crime rate of 107 local areas in Heaton and the 129th lowest crime rate of 1,554 local areas in Bradford .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 17.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-27.9%.
